Rogers Communications (TSE:RCI.A) Shares Cross Above Fifty Day Moving Average - Here's Why

Rogers Communications logo with Communication Services background

Rogers Communications Inc. (TSE:RCI.A - Get Free Report)'s stock price passed above its 50 day moving average during trading on Friday . The stock has a 50 day moving average of C$41.86 and traded as high as C$49.70. Rogers Communications shares last traded at C$48.21, with a volume of 4,048 shares trading hands.

Rogers Communications Stock Performance

The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 436.50, a current ratio of 0.65 and a quick ratio of 0.58. The firm has a fifty day moving average price of C$42.03 and a two-hundred day moving average price of C$42.96. The stock has a market capitalization of C$5.36 billion, a PE ratio of 29.58, a P/E/G ratio of 0.95 and a beta of 0.62.

Rogers Communications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Rogers is the largest wireless service provider in Canada, with its more than 10 million subscribers equating to one third of the total Canadian market. Rogers' wireless business accounted for 60% of the company's total sales in 2021 and has increasingly provided a bigger portion of total company sales over the last several years.
